DeepBach

This repository contains the implementation of the DeepBach model described in

DeepBach: a Steerable Model for Bach chorales generation
Gaëtan Hadjeres, François Pachet
arXiv preprint arXiv:1612.01010

The code uses python 3.5 together with Keras and music21 libraries.

Installation

You can download and install DeepBach's dependencies with the following commands:

git clone [email protected]:SonyCSL-Paris/DeepBach.git
cd DeepBach
sudo pip3 install -r requirements.txt

Make sure either Theano or Tensorflow is installed. You also need to configure properly the music editor called by music21.

Usage

 usage: deepBach.py [-h] [--timesteps TIMESTEPS] [-b BATCH_SIZE_TRAIN]
                   [-s SAMPLES_PER_EPOCH] [--num_val_samples NUM_VAL_SAMPLES]
                   [-u NUM_UNITS_LSTM [NUM_UNITS_LSTM ...]] [-d NUM_DENSE]
                   [-n {deepbach,mlp,maxent}] [-i NUM_ITERATIONS] [-t [TRAIN]]
                   [-p [PARALLEL]] [--overwrite] [-m [MIDI_FILE]] [-l LENGTH]
                   [--ext EXT]

optional arguments:
  -h, --help            show this help message and exit
  --timesteps TIMESTEPS
                        model's range (default: 16)
  -b BATCH_SIZE_TRAIN, --batch_size_train BATCH_SIZE_TRAIN
                        batch size used during training phase (default: 128)
  -s SAMPLES_PER_EPOCH, --samples_per_epoch SAMPLES_PER_EPOCH
                        number of samples per epoch (default: 89600)
  --num_val_samples NUM_VAL_SAMPLES
                        number of validation samples (default: 1280)
  -u NUM_UNITS_LSTM [NUM_UNITS_LSTM ...], --num_units_lstm NUM_UNITS_LSTM [NUM_UNITS_LSTM ...]
                        number of lstm units (default: [200, 200])
  -d NUM_DENSE, --num_dense NUM_DENSE
                        size of non recurrent hidden layers (default: 200)
  -n {deepbach,mlp,maxent}, --name {deepbach,mlp,maxent}
                        model name (default: deepbach)
  -i NUM_ITERATIONS, --num_iterations NUM_ITERATIONS
                        number of gibbs iterations (default: 20000)
  -t [TRAIN], --train [TRAIN]
                        train models for N epochs (default: 15)
  -p [PARALLEL], --parallel [PARALLEL]
                        number of parallel updates (default: 16)
  --overwrite           overwrite previously computed models
  -m [MIDI_FILE], --midi_file [MIDI_FILE]
                        relative path to midi file
  -l LENGTH, --length LENGTH
                        length of unconstrained generation
  --ext EXT             extension of model name
  -o [OUTPUT_FILE], --output_file [OUTPUT_FILE]
                        path to output file

Examples

Generate a chorale of length 100:

python3 deepBach.py -l 100

Create a DeepBach model with three stacked lstm layers of size 200, hidden layers of size 500 and train it for 10 epochs before sampling:

python3 deepBach.py --ext big -u 200 200 200 -d 500 -t 10

Generate chorale harmonization with soprano extracted from midi/file/path.mid using parallel Gibbs sampling with 10000 updates (total number of updates)

python3 deepBach.py -m midi/file/path.mid -p -i 10000

Default values load pre-trained DeepBach model and generate a chorale using sequential Gibbs sampling with 20000 iterations
